Commencement 2005<br />
The Class <strong>of</strong> 2005 on the steps <strong>of</strong> Portland City Hall.<br />
The <strong>Maine</strong> <strong>Law</strong> Alumni Association gained 96 members<br />
on Saturday, May 28, when the Class <strong>of</strong> 2005 celebrated<br />
their graduation from the <strong>University</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Maine</strong> <strong>School</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Law</strong><br />
during their Commencement ceremony at Merrill<br />
Auditorium in Portland.<br />
Annmarie Levins ’83, associate general counsel for<br />
Micros<strong>of</strong>t Corporation, was invited by the graduating class to<br />
give the keynote address. She focused her remarks on four<br />
lessons that she said have been <strong>of</strong> great importance to her<br />
throughout her legal career. They were:<br />
• “You don’t have to know all the answers, but you do<br />
have to ask the right questions.”<br />
15<br />
• “Keep an open mind, recognizing the real possibility that<br />
you may be wrong.”<br />
• “Something is only impossible until someone does it.”<br />
• “Know who you are and what you believe.”<br />
Levins advised graduates “you will need to have a strong<br />
moral compass and be willing to follow it, even when it<br />
would be easier not to.” She told the class that, in order to be<br />
successful, they would need to have more than just good<br />
legal skills. Levins urged the graduates to take time to understand<br />
people and how to work effectively with them. She<br />
concluded her address with, “I hope that you will find that<br />
you love being a lawyer as much as I do.”<br />
